Nicky Byrne reveals he’s ‘hopeful’ Dancing With The Stars will return next year

Nicky Byrne has revealed he’s “hopeful” that Dancing With The Stars will return next year.

The Westlife star co-hosts the popular show, which was cancelled this year due to the coronavirus pandemic, with Jennifer Zamparelli.

Speaking at RTÉ’s new season launch about the series, Nicky said: “Officially it’s not back yet, but it’s not not back. I’m hearing some positive signs which is a good thing.”

“Obviously it’s a huge production with a huge crew, so I guess it’s about negotiating all of that under the government restrictions. I know they’re trying their best to tick all those boxes,” he explained.

“It’s exciting if it does happen, I think we all need a bit of glitter in our lives. It’s a fun, easy show to do… I think if it does come back, it’ll be well worth the wait having missed last year and the final the year before.”

“I’m hopeful. But as we’re only too well aware, we’ve seen how quickly things can change from opening up to the strict lockdowns, to different variants – anything can change in a heartbeat.”

“At the moment, I think things are moving in the right direction, but are we over the line with the green light yet? I haven’t heard that no. So let’s just say fingers crossed.”

Nicky will host a brand new talent series on RTÉ this autumn called Last Singer Standing – a karaoke-inspired game show where singers from around Ireland compete to win a €25k prize.

Pop superstars Nadine Coyle, Joey Fatone and Samantha Mumba will be joining the show as panelists, offering their expert opinions and advice throughout the series.

Speaking about the new show, Nicky said: “It’s a new format, it’s not tired like previous talent shows became after so many years on television.”

“It’s just a really interesting game show, but it involves singing and has a great pot panel… I think it’s got the ability to break across America, even to break into Asia. This could go far and beyond and I hope it does.”
